Walter Harry Finnall

Born 1799 - Died 1861

Walter Harry Finnall (1799-1861) was the son of Robert Monteith Finnall (1776-1847) of Stafford.  He was a slave trader and broker in the 1830s and also operated the Tump Fishery near Aquia Landing for many years.  Walter H. Finnall married Elizabeth F. Bridwell (1805-1875).  His son, Morgan Lewis Finnall (1830-1901), continued the Tump Fishery after the Civil War.
